OnePlus Buds Pro 2 review: Quality earbuds under Rs. 12,000

The OPPO Enco X2 has been sitting comfortably at the top of the midrange mountain since its release. It has hardly been challenged by anything that came before or after it in the Rs. 9,000 to Rs. 12,000 range or even a little higher. Finally, a challenger has emerged, and it seems to be equipped with similar tools on paper as the Enco X2. Be it the driver configuration or codec support at launch or active noise cancellation (ANC), things seem evenly matched.
